The Legacy of Emmitt Douglas

Season 4 Episode 11 | 27m 35s

The Legacy of Emmitt Douglas

Genevieve takes a look at the life of the late Emmitt Douglas, president of the NAACP during the civil rights era; Rob talks to Judge Robert Collins of New Orleans, the first black Federal Judge in the Deep South; feature on latch key children, an after school program offer at the Old Hammond YMCA in Baton Rouge.
